Sustainable Skincare, 5 Factors you Need to Consider
When it comes to buying sustainable skincare, there are several factors to consider in order to ensure that you are making the most eco-friendly and ethical choices. Here are a few things to think about:
- Packaging - Look for products that come in packaging that is made from recycled materials or that can be easily recycled. Avoid products that come in single-use packaging or packaging that is difficult to recycle.
- Ingredients - Look for products that are made with natural, plant-based ingredients that are grown and harvested in an eco-friendly manner. Avoid products that contain synthetic chemicals or ingredients that may be harmful to the environment.
- Certifications - Look for products that have certifications such as USDA Organic, Leaping Bunny, or Cruelty-Free International, which indicate that the product has been produced in a sustainable and ethical manner.
- Company values - Research the values and practices of the companies whose products you are considering. Look for companies that prioritize sustainability and ethical sourcing in their business practices.
- Transparency - Look for companies that are transparent about their ingredients, production processes, and sustainability practices. This can help you make informed decisions about the products you are buying.
By considering these factors, you can make more sustainable and ethical choices when it comes to your skincare routine. Remember to also recycle or properly dispose of your empty skincare containers to further reduce your impact on the environment.
